You mentioned that you have not found a phaser you're happy with...have you tried the maxon rotary phaser? It is pricy, but I liked it the best and use it regularly. Interestingly, my second favorite was the small stone nano at 1/4 the price.

Re: If you had to limit your rig to 3 pedals - what would you choose?

noise suppressor in the front end
phaser in the front end
delay in the loop of a high-gain amp.

My next purchase after some new pickups will be the Moog phaser and Boss DD-6 delay to replace my Rocktron Xpression, which I just use for phase and delay. The Moog accepts 4 expression pedals (I can't wait for that fun) so I'm hoping one application of the Moog will be as an uber-wah; my Vox wah has an inch of dust on it.
